Latest Patents
Sato's latest patents include notable inventions such as the **Waterproof Type Substrate Housing Case** and the **Rotary Electric Machine**. The Waterproof Type Substrate Housing Case is a remarkable design that provides a hermetic seal for the circuit substrate using a combination of metal and resin materials. This innovative case employs an engaging elastic member which ensures a secure attachment between the components, enhancing durability and functionality.
The Rotary Electric Machine patent outlines the structure of an efficient electric machine that includes crucial elements such as a stator, rotor, and various supportive components. This design aims to improve the operational efficiency and reliability of electric machines, showcasing Sato's ability to contribute to essential technologies in the industry.
